Softball Recap: Georgetown Day Mighty Hoppers vs. Bullis Bulldogs
There's no place like home for Georgetown Day, who bounced back after a loss on the road last Tuesday. They put the hurt on the Bullis Bulldogs with a sharp 17-2 win on Friday. For Georgetown Day, this counts as revenge for the 10-6 loss Bullis walked away with the last time they faced one another back in March.
Natalie Ogden made a splash no matter where she played. She pitched three innings while giving up just two earned runs off two hits. Ogden was also big at the plate, scoring two runs and stealing a base. Ogden is crushing it when it comes to stolen bases: she's stolen at least one every time she's taken the field this season.
In other batting news, Georgetown Day got a massive performance out of Corina Bellerman, who scored three runs and stole a base while going 2-for-4. Ella Lynn was another key contributor, scoring three runs and stealing a base while going 2-for-2.
The victory got Georgetown Day back to even at 2-2. As for Bullis, their defeat ended a three-game streak of away wins and brought them to 5-3.
Georgetown Day will head out on the road to take on St. Stephen's & St. Agnes at 4:30 p.m. on Tuesday. Georgetown Day knows how to get runs on the board -- the squad has finished with flashy run totals in its past three contests -- so hopefully St. Stephen's & St. Agnes likes a good challenge. As for Bullis, they will get a bit of extra time to process the loss as their next game is a ways off. They'll take on Sidwell Friends at 4:30 p.m. on April 29th.
